THE RISE OF CREDITOR-LAUNCHED CCAA PROCEEDINGS: HOW LENDERS ARE TAKING CONTROL IN 2026 THE RISE OF CREDITOR-LAUNCHED CCAA PROCEEDINGS: HOW LENDERS ARE TAKING CONTROL IN 2026 The landscape of Canadian business restructuring is shifting. Traditionally, the Companies' Creditors Arrangement Act (CCAA) was a tool used by companies to protect themselves from creditors. But in 2026, we are seeing the rise of the "Creditor-Launched CCAA." In this video, Brandon Smith from Ira Smith Trustee & Receiver Inc. breaks down why sophisticated lenders are no longer waiting for a company to file for protection. Instead, they are taking the initiative to launch CCAA proceedings themselves to control the restructuring, the sale process, and the future of the business. If your company has over $5 million in debt, understanding this trend is critical to your survival.
